Dear Sister Dina, My question is how long is the process of becoming a sister? – From Bryce Crosley via Facebook Dear Bryce, The process of becoming a sister can be long. It is driven by prayerful discernment in living out the Congregation’s God-given mission within community. ...Ind., which is now listed in the National Register of Historic Places. Saint Mother Theodore Guerin founded the Sisters of Providence at Saint Mary-of-the-Woods in 1840. Today, Sisters of Providence minister in 13 states, the District of Columbia and Asia, through works of love, mercy and justice.
